Ordinals
beta
Address bc1q5jzcw05m4jzfn5rd3h5epqwpujpg2sd6pwu466
sat balance
44156
runes balances
outputs
1139301948980f160a0b029ebdf837b18c674f506b540397812d394c757d2023:1